AI summary

Mangalam Global Enterprise Limited reported strong FY26 results with standalone revenue of Rs. 29,617 Lakhs (up 41.5% YoY) and net profit of Rs. 4,137 Lakhs (up 90% YoY). Consolidated revenue reached Rs. 33,845 Lakhs with net profit of Rs. 4,522 Lakhs. The Board recommended a final dividend of Rs. 0.01 per equity share (1% of face value Rs. 1), aggregating Rs. 32.96 Lakhs, subject to shareholder approval at the ensuing AGM. The company also appointed new internal and cost auditors for FY27. Additional disclosures note a SEBI show cause notice from February 2025 regarding a forensic audit, with the company having filed a settlement application.
